Song Tar Toh is a scholar working on Physiology, Pulmonary and Respiratory Medicine and Endocrine and Autonomic Systems. According to data from OpenAlex, Song Tar Toh has authored 46 papers receiving a total of 577 indexed citations (citations by other indexed papers that have themselves been cited), including 30 papers in Physiology, 25 papers in Pulmonary and Respiratory Medicine and 13 papers in Endocrine and Autonomic Systems. Recurrent topics in Song Tar Toh’s work include Obstructive Sleep Apnea Research (29 papers), Tracheal and airway disorders (14 papers) and Neuroscience of respiration and sleep (13 papers). Song Tar Toh is often cited by papers focused on Obstructive Sleep Apnea Research (29 papers), Tracheal and airway disorders (14 papers) and Neuroscience of respiration and sleep (13 papers). Song Tar Toh collaborates with scholars based in Singapore, United States and Israel. Song Tar Toh's co-authors include Anna See, Stephanie Fook‐Chong, Wong‐Kein Low, De Yun Wang, Joseph Wee, Benjamin Kye Jyn Tan, Nicole Kye Wen Tan, Yao Hao Teo, Neville Wei Yang Teo and Dominic Wei Ting Yap and has published in prestigious journals such as Journal of Clinical Oncology, PLoS ONE and Annals of Oncology.
